2. Automation

With audiences congregating in digital and social environments like never before, marketers are facing much more convoluted and unorganized spaces compared to that of television, radio, and print. In turn, it only makes sense that workflow tools and means of communicating with customers address that environment. Whether it's using bots when it comes to messaging customers over Facebook or using an actual software for social content, automation is a must for any marketer's toolbox.

3. Integration of Virtual & Augmented Reality

Though we are still in the early stages of using VR and AR in terms of marketing and branding, audiences are watching. VR and AR offer the perfect opportunity to create innovative and immersive experiences that audiences are craving. If anything, I think we're going to see a lot of experimentation with VR and AR content over the next year. 4. New Features Galore

One thing 2016 didn't lack was platform updates and new features. From Facebook Live Map, Instagram Stories, Twitter Moments, and all the way to Snapchat Spectacles - social media has become a playground for marketers.Throughout the next 12 months, I think we're going to see exactly what updates are worth the time to master. The majority of these updates enable users to create and distribute real-time, genuine experiences. Marketers need to hone in on this form of content and ensure that their social media strategy can resonate with the preferences of their audience. 5. Influencers Continue to Reign

I don't have to tell you the amount of clutter and noise that's out there - let alone how difficult it is to be seen and heard above it. Influencers will continue to attract audiences, acquire prospects, and convert leads through innovative, authentic content. Bloggers, vloggers, thought leaders and celebrities - they all have the ability to resonate with niche audiences and marketers through a shared passion that goes beyond your brand.
